Corgi 1109
Corgi 1109 Bloodhound Guided Missile on Loading Trolley. Near mint plus - very near mint/boxed, with all inner packing, Leaflet & Booklet. From The Old School Collection.
Notes
Issued between 1959-61.
The Loading Trolley has a pleasing matt original military green finish.
Functioning mechanism for raising and lowering the missile. Barely a mark to the paint finish – looks completely unused.
The Bristol Bloodhound Guided Missile has fared better than usual too with a well-shaped nose cone and just a few of the usual little exposed edge marks to the paint finish. Complete roundels. This two-piece set presents well!
The colourful pictorial box is clean and complete with both upper and lower card packing pieces.
Light edge rubbing and a small area of surface loss at a lid side.Light pencilled numbering on the lid face in one small area. Small edge indentation.
Nice to see that the original Instruction Leaflet as well as the promotional Booklet present.
